Ingredients

30 minutes
4 servings
  1. 1/4 Ctable salt for brining
  2. 2# shell on jumbo shrimp
  3. 1/4 Coil
  4. 3scallions, sliced thin only using green parts
  5. 2garlic cloves, minced
  6. 1 tspfennel seeds
  7. 1/2 tspred pepper flakes

Steps

30 minutes
  1. 1

    Dissolve 1/4C salt in 1 qt cold water in a large container. Using kitchen shears, cut through shrimp shells; devein but do not remove shell. Using a paring knife, cut 1/2" deep slit in each shrimp along the vein line, be careful not to cut the shrimp in half completely. Submerge shrimp in brine; cover, refrigerate for 15 minutes.

  2. 2

    Adjust the oven rack 4" from broiler and heat broiler.

  3. 3

    Combine 1/4C oil, scallion greens, garlic, fennel seeds and pepper flakes in a large bowl. Remove shrimp from brine and pat dry with paper towels. Toss shrimp in the oil mixture. Spread shrimp on a wire rack set in a baking sheet.

  4. 4

    Broil shrimp until just browned, about 2-4 minutes per side, rotating sheet halfway through broiling: transfer shrimp to serving platter. Serve with your favorite side dish.
